Read the given passage and answer the questions that follow.

Gutenberg Bible, also called 42-line Bible was the first complete book extant in the West and
one of the earliest printed from movable type, so called after its printer, Johannes Gutenberg.
Gutenbarg completed it in 1455 while working at Mainz, Germany. The three-volume work, in
Latin text, was printed in 42-line columns and, in its later stages of production, was worked on
by six compositors simultaneously. It is sometimes referred to as the Mazarin Bible because
the first copy described by bibliographers was located in the Paris library of Cardinal Mazarin.
The Anthology of Great Buddhist Priests’ Zen Teachings (1377), also known as Jikji, was
printed in Korea 78 years before the Gutenberg Bible and is recognized as the world’s oldest
extant movable metal type book.
Like other contemporary works, the Gutenberg Bible had no title page, no page numbers, and
no innovations to distinguish it from the work of a manuscript copyist. This was presumably
the desire of both Gutenberg and his customers. Experts are generally agreed that the Bible,
though uneconomic in its use of space, displays a technical efficiency not substantially
improved upon before the 19th century. The Gothic type is majestic in appearance, medieval
in feeling, and slightly less compressed and less pointed than other examples that appeared
shortly thereafter.
The original number of copies of this work is unknown; some 40 are still in existence. There
are perfect vellum copies kept in the U.S. Library of Congress, the French Bibliothèque
Nationale, and the British Library. In the United States almost complete texts are preserved in
the Huntington, Morgan, New York Public, Harvard University, and Yale University libraries.
